Coda is in need of a new home because she is no longer getting along with her canine housemate and has begun fighting with her. This is a heartbreaking time for her family as she has been a part of the family for 6 years, after adopting her from a local shelter. 

She has been designated as a Potentially Dangerous Dog in Howard County, Maryland after an incident with a neighbor's dog: 

 

We recently moved into a new house. The backyard was clear but a neighbor brought their dog to the edge of our property. The neighbor's dog made the initial lunge and attacked my dogs. There was a fight that was promptly broken up by myself. My dogs received puncture wounds as well as the other dog. The neighbors called animal control. My dogs received a "Potentially Dangerous" declaration from Howard County even though the neighbor's dog initiated the attack and may have initiated it on my property.

She has lived in a home with a 3 year old child. 

She is spayed, vaccinated, microchipped, and she is house-trained and crate-trained.

Rescue Well was founded by Christine Sandberg in Baltimore, Maryland in 2011. Since its launch, it’s grown from offering post-adoption support to the city shelter, to offering several programs across Maryland, Washington, DC, and Northern Virginia. Our Programs focus on improving the lives of both pets and its owners. We proudly serve without judgment or expectations and we strictly follow our Rescue Well Engagement Model: ENGAGE > EDUCATE > EMPOWER.

Our organization’s programs are run by volunteers who are actively engaged in front-line intervention, community support, shelter support, and re-homing services for all pets.
